大量长期收购微信公众号老号 但要半年以上的老号 并且无不良记录 没有屏蔽 最好个人用的,能取消QQ绑定

Windows 下的 Nodejs
为什么搞这个?
公司电脑的权限管理比较严,不能安装软件,不能常驻系统进程等,所以像 xampp 之类的都不能正常执行
我又想在空闲的时候做点东西
所以坑爹的我只能自己研究在windows下运行nodejs了
怎么执行?
下载并解压到一个目录
进入目录双击 Start.bat 执行
在命令行下执行 node ex_project\jade\app.jse\app.js
&div class='bogus-wrapper'&&notextile&&figure class='code'&&div&&table&&tr&&td&&pre&&span class='line-number'&1&/span& &/pre&&/td&&td class='code'&&pre&&code class=''&&span class='line'&E:\nodejs4win&node ex_project\jade\app.js Express server listening on port 3000 in development mode&/span&&/code&&/pre&&/td&&/tr&&/table&&/div&&/figure&&/notextile&&/div&
这样的结果,那么打开浏览器输入:
&div class='bogus-wrapper'&&notextile&&figure class='code'&&div&&table&&tr&&td&&pre&&span class='line-number'&1&/span& &/pre&&/td&&td class='code'&&pre&&code class=''&&span class='line'&E:\nodejs4win&node ex_project\jade\app.js Express server listening on port 3000 in development mode&/span&&/code&&/pre&&/td&&/tr&&/table&&/div&&/figure&&/notextile&&/div&
OK,这样一个 nodejs + express + jade 的项目就跑起来了
所有 windows 都可以执行吗?
在 Windows Xp 下可以直接执行,不需要权限
在 Windows 7 下本地执行的话不需要 windows 权限,局域网内执行的话,需要开放局域网访问的权限。
都有什么?
nodejs.exe – windows 版 nodejs
npm – nodejs 的模板库管理工具,但windows下很多库都不能直接安装使用
express – mvc framework
jade – template
dot – template
ejs – template
Tenjin – template
jst – template ,有错误,还未修复
dirty – 因为windows 下数据库还不支持,所以只能采用一些其他的工具替换了。这个是目前我找到的最好的工具了。
n2Mvc – 国人开发的一个独立的轻型的mvc架构
刚接触nodejs的建议先从project 目录下的代码看起,从最简单的hello_world,到n2mvc,可以让你对Nodejs有一个初步的了解
然后可以在express的模板中选一套主攻吧
这套环境可以用来生产吗?
你开玩笑呢?哥,这个只是让你折腾玩的,想到生产环境还是用Linux吧,虽然我现在是做.net的,但我还是觉得windows不适合做服务器。
这些都是你写的吗?
不是,我只是把他们拼在一起。我会在后面给出他们的项目地址。
有文档可以参考吗?
nodejs官方文档: http://nodejs.org/docs/latest/api/process.html#process.platform
国内社区的翻译版(未完成):http://cnodejs.org/cman/all.html
nodecn 翻译的文档(未完成):http://www.nodecn.org/all.html
Express JS 中文入门指引手册:/tools/express-js/express-guide-reference-zh-CN.html
有问题了问谁?
可以去cnodejs.org社区提问
可以去各项目主页发 Issues
也可以直接在我的项目主页留言等,我会尽量解答
项目【下载】地址
/DrayChou/nodejs4win
引用到的项目地址
nodejs : http://nodejs.org/
express : /visionmedia/express
dirty : /felixge/node-dirty
n2Mvc : /QLeelulu/n2Mvc
jade : /visionmedia/jade
dot : /olado/doT
nTenjin : /QLeelulu/nTenjin
ejs : /visionmedia/ejs
jst : /shaunlee/node-jst
Node.js 的详细介绍:
Node.js 的下载地址:
转载请注明:文章转载自 开源中国社区
本文标题:Windows 下的 Nodejs
本文地址:
为什么不行?nodejs 的并发性能还是不错的,做一个多并发少数据的处理还是很不错的node.js event driven的概念很好,但是语言实在是太垃圾了!javascript是一种脑残的语言,it will cause you permanent brain damage!javascript 的語言設計的時候確實不是很好,但是寫的不好卻不能怪javascript
html5就是javascriptwhy html5 == javascript!!!!你仔细看html5就知道了。就多了标签。其他全是javascript实现html5 不是 javascript ,应该说是由新的 css 标准和 js 等组成的在html5,没有javascript什么都不是沒有javascript
是不能完成很多動態效果,但是不能說html5就是javascript
为什么不行?nodejs 的并发性能还是不错的,做一个多并发少数据的处理还是很不错的node.js event driven的概念很好,但是语言实在是太垃圾了!javascript是一种脑残的语言,it will cause you permanent brain damage!
html5就是javascriptwhy html5 == javascript!!!!你仔细看html5就知道了。就多了标签。其他全是javascript实现html5 不是 javascript ,应该说是由新的 css 标准和 js 等组成的在html5,没有javascript什么都不是
html5就是javascriptwhy html5 == javascript!!!!你仔细看html5就知道了。就多了标签。其他全是javascript实现html5 不是 javascript ,应该说是由新的 css 标准和 js 等组成的
为什么不行?nodejs 的并发性能还是不错的,做一个多并发少数据的处理还是很不错的
做.net开发的公司
基于javaScript因为没有管理员权限,没法启动服务,所以当时只能用 Nodejs 了
html5就是javascriptwhy html5 == javascript!!!!你仔细看html5就知道了。就多了标签。其他全是javascript实现晕,不用js用啥,js调用的那些api也是html5里的啊
html5就是javascriptwhy html5 == javascript!!!!你仔细看html5就知道了。就多了标签。其他全是javascript实现
有点偏激了哈学了这么多语言真的发现js是非常垃圾的语言.不过主要是还是因为一些兼容性造成的,给开发者感觉很乱.不像后端语言,统一标准.一般一个语言就一个解释器或是编译器.你可以用coffeescript,jquery等等 。javascript不是垃圾
html5就是javascriptwhy html5 == javascript!!!!
有点偏激了哈学了这么多语言真的发现js是非常垃圾的语言.不过主要是还是因为一些兼容性造成的,给开发者感觉很乱.不像后端语言,统一标准.一般一个语言就一个解释器或是编译器.C编译器满地球都是,照这个理论,C也成垃圾语言了。盆友,ECMAScript才是标准,Javascript其实是衍生版本…
有点偏激了哈学了这么多语言真的发现js是非常垃圾的语言.不过主要是还是因为一些兼容性造成的,给开发者感觉很乱.不像后端语言,统一标准.一般一个语言就一个解释器或是编译器.
有点偏激了哈
html5就是javascriptNodeJS 加入windows7服务 开机运行 nssm - CNode技术社区
这家伙很懒,什么个性签名都没有留下。
首先需要到http://nssm.cc/download/?page=download 下载 nssm
下下来之后是压缩包形式的,解压之后 ctrl + R 进入cmd 命令行界面
在命令行模式下进入到nssm的目录, 注意是32位或64位的系统进入相应的目录。
之后运行:
nssm install NodeJS “\node.exe” “\server.js” net start NodeJS
nssm install NodeJS(安装后的服务名称) “(node.exe安装的地址)\node.exe” “(要启动的JS文件)\server.js” net start NodeJS(安装后的服务名称)
最后要卸载服务用 nssm remove NodeJS(安装后的服务名称)
装上是可以用,但是日志咋办?
asdfasdfasdf
![Blockquote][1]
var fs = require('fs');
var accessLogfile = fs.createWriteStream('access.log',{flags:'a'});
app.use(express.logger({stream:accessLogfile}));
app.configure('production', function(){
app.use(function(err,req,res,next){
var meta = '[' + new Date() + ']' + req.url + '\n';
errorLogfile.write(meta + err.stack + '\n');
可以生成日志!
如果我想实时的监控日志咋办?这种生成的日志用于生产阶段还行,开发阶段看着麻烦
开发阶段就停止服务在命令行下操作,或者用WebStorm
或者设置成开发阶段
app.set('env','development');
app.configure('development', function(){
app.use(express.errorHandler());
CNode 社区为国内最专业的 Node.js 开源技术社区,致力于 Node.js 的技术研究。
服务器赞助商为
,存储赞助商为
,由提供应用性能服务。
新手搭建 Node.js 服务器,推荐使用无需备案的& & & & 我们不可能直接通过node命令来管理远程站点,这样无法保证网站的可持续运行。我们用Forever来解决这个问题,它可以将NodeJS应用以后台守护进程的方式运行,我们还可以将NodeJS应用设成随系统启动而自动运行。& & 首先,安装F……
声明:该文章系网友上传分享,此内容仅代表网友个人经验或观点,不代表本网站立场和观点;若未进行原创声明,则表明该文章系转载自互联网;若该文章内容涉嫌侵权,请及时向
论文写作技巧
上一篇:下一篇:
相关经验教程node.js应用后台守护进程管理器Forever安装和使用实例
字体:[ ] 类型:转载 时间:
这篇文章主要介绍了node.js应用后台守护进程管理器Forever安装和使用实例,forever可以看做是一个nodejs的守护进程,能够启动,停止,重启我们的app应用,需要的朋友可以参考下
我们不可能直接通过node命令来管理远程站点,这样无法保证网站的可持续运行。我们用Forever来解决这个问题,它可以将NodeJS应用以后台守护进程的方式运行,我们还可以将NodeJS应用设成随系统启动而自动运行。
首先,安装Forever: 代码如下:npm install forever -gd这样Forever就安装好了,我们可以直接运行Forever命令: 代码如下:forever --helpforever start app.jsforever stop app.js上面命令先查看Forever帮助文件,然后运行app.js,然后停止app.js。我们要让Forever自动运行,先在/etc/init.d目录创建一个文件node,内容如下: 代码如下:#!/bin/bash## node&&&&& Start up node server daemon## chkconfig: 345 85 15# description: Forever for Node.js#PATH=/home/node/0.8.9/binDEAMON=/home/ftp/1520/weizt--/app.jsLOG=/home/hosts_logPID=/tmp/forever.pidcase "$1" in&&& start)&&&&&&& forever start -l $LOG/forever.log -o $LOG/forever_out.log -e $LOG/forever_err.log --pidFile $PID -a $DEAMON&&& stop)&&&&&&& forever stop --pidFile $PID $DEAMON&&& stopall)&&&&&&& forever stopall --pidFile $PID&&& restartall)&&&&&&& forever restartall --pidFile $PID&&& reload|restart)&&&&&&& forever restart -l $LOG/forever.log -o $LOG/forever_out.log -e $LOG/forever_err.log --pidFile $PID -a $DEAMON&&& list)&&&&&&& forever list&&& *)&&&&&&& echo "Usage: /etc.init.d/node {start|stop|restart|reload|stopall|restartall|list}"&&&&&&& exit 1esacexit 0以上代码是我在本地虚拟机的配置,根据实际情况修改相关参数,主要是DEAMON的路径参数,赋予该文件可执行权限,并运行chkconfig添加自动运行: 代码如下:chmod 755 /etc/init.d/nodechkconfig /etc/init.d/node onreboot重启系统,通过浏览器进入网站可发现,该NodeJS已经可自动运行了,剩下的工作,就是好好研究NodeJS、Express和AngularJS,做一个真正属于自己的应用!
您可能感兴趣的文章:
大家感兴趣的内容
12345678910
最近更新的内容
常用在线小工具PHP开发框架
开发工具/编程工具
服务器环境
ThinkSAAS商业授权:
ThinkSAAS为用户提供有偿个性定制开发服务
ThinkSAAS将为商业授权用户提供二次开发指导和技术支持
让ThinkSAAS更好,把建议拿来。
开发客服微信}

我要回帖

更多关于 收购微信公众号 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信